Long story, but there are big differences between 5.56 and 223. The easiest way to handle the situation there is make sure you have a barrel that is truly chambered in 5.56 or a Wylde chamber.
The 75 Amax is a long bullet and you will not be able to load it for AR mag length.
It also may or may not stabilize in the 1 in 9 twist. For heavy bullets in that twist you should use the 69 SMK or the 75 MHP that is loaded by Black Hills (my choice). IUt should stabilize well in the 1 in 9.
